Description
Gekiryûjin is a Brave robot formed when FuuRyuu (G.B.R.-06) and RaiRyuu (G.B.R.-07) achieve 100% synchronization in their SympaRate, executing Symmetrical Docking. This 28-meter tall, 18-meter wide Docking Vehicle type G-Stone Driven Brave Robot weighs 465 tons. Powered by an Ul-Tech Unified G-Drive with a 9,500,000 kW output, it achieves a maximum running speed of 205 km/h and a maximum flying speed of Mach 0.7. Shoulder-mounted SP Packs aid maneuvering in space, while attaching the supply ship Climber-1 to its back provides extra thrust and power.

Compared to ChouRyuuJin, Gekiryûjin exhibits a more offensive design and combat approach, reflecting RaiRyuu's rougher demeanor and speech pattern. It integrates equipment from both components: RaiRyuu's left forearm-mounted Electric Gun, FuuRyuu's wind-based Jiao-Ban-Ji 4-tube cannon (shaped like a mixing drum), and the Dian-Zhuang-Huo electromagnetic carrier. The Dian-Zhuang-Huo serves as a hoverboard, shield, and ramming/chopping weapon, mounting the Lei-Dun electrical discharger for offensive and defensive manipulation, which also forms Gekiryûjin's chest armor.

Its primary finishing move, Shuang-Tou-Long, generates a yellow and a green energy dragon from its arms. These dragons penetrate defenses like Zonder fields or Primevals to safely retrieve cores undamaged; their energy density even supports allied units like ChouRyuuJin as combat platforms. Gekiryûjin uniquely deploys a desperation attack while docked: FuuRyuu’s self-destruct bomb, concealed in its right arm, used against the Sol Masters in FINAL to overload enemy Loud G-Stones.

Gekiryûjin first fused after FuuRyuu and RaiRyuu reconciled upon witnessing their predecessors' resolve, destroying a combined Zonder Robo and retrieving 42 Zonder Cores. A theoretical combination with G.B.R.-05 ShouRyuu to form ShouGekiRyuuJin exists but remains unused in official media. During the FINAL Sol Masters battle, it employed its self-destruct against Ptulone and used Shuang-Tou-Long to counter electromagnetic tornado attacks.
